Title: A Flowchart of the Property Preservation Process for Bank Applications
When individuals are facing financial difficulties and unable to repay their debts, banks may apply for property preservation to ensure that their assets are protected. In this article, we will discuss the step-by-step process of how banks can apply for property preservation and secure their interests.
Step 1: Confirm the Debtor’s Default Status
Before banks can apply for property preservation, they first need to confirm that the debtor has defaulted on their loan agreement. This can be done by reviewing the loan agreement and the payment history. If the debtor is found to be in default, the bank can proceed with the property preservation process.
Step 2: File a Request for Property Preservation
Banks must then file a request for property preservation with the court that has jurisdiction over the debtor’s location. This request should include details about the debtor’s default status, the amount owed, and the assets that the bank wishes to preserve. The court will then review the request and issue an order for property preservation if it deems it necessary.
Step 3: Notify the Debtor
Once the court has issued an order for property preservation, the bank must notify the debtor about the preservation request through a legal notice. The notice should include the court’s order, the assets that the bank wishes to preserve, and the debtor’s right to appeal the order.
Step 4: Perform Property Preservation
After the debtor has been notified, the bank can proceed with preserving the assets. This involves hiring a bailiff or a court enforcement officer to seize and secure the assets in question. The seized assets will remain in the custody of the bailiff until the court decides to release them.
Step 5: Attend Court Hearings
The bank will need to attend court hearings to provide evidence of the debtor’s default status and explain why property preservation is necessary. The debtor will also have the opportunity to challenge the order and present their case.
Step 6: Receive Payment or Foreclose on the Assets
If the court determines that the debtor is indeed in default, the bank can then receive payment out of the preserved assets or foreclose on the assets to recoup their losses.
